Core Cooling Technology
The primary differentiator of this fan is its
semiconductor cooling pad. Images highlight this component, suggesting a direct cooling mechanism. Unlike standard portable fans that simply move ambient air, this device aims to actively reduce air temperature. This is a significant upgrade.
This technology implies a Peltier effect, where an electric current transfers heat from one side of a module to the other. The visible metallic element at the fan's core is likely this cooling pad. Such a system offers a more effective cooling experience than simple airflow.
